Check out how many older Airstreams are for sale. Then try to find one of those "other" brands of that age.
Sunline has been making trailers for 40 years. They just had a contest to find the oldest one. The best they could do was a 1974! Now go out and see how many Airstreams you can find that are even older than that.
They last, nearly forever. The skin and superstructure are all made of aluminum. The other ones are made of wood!
